Elk Grove Village Investor Qualifies Three Thoroughbred Horses for the Kentucky Derby Weekend's Biggest Races

CHURCHILL DOWNS, Kentucky (April 29, 2015) - Donegal Racing, a thoroughbred race horse partnership, is making history at Kentucky's Churchill Downs this weekend. For only the second time in the track's 141-year history, one stable-Donegal-has horses in Churchill Downs' three signature races. Area investors Jon Metcalf along with Donegal Racing have joint ownership in all three horses.

Puca will be in the Kentucky Oaks on Friday, May 1. Finnegan's Wake will be in the Woodford Reserve, followed by Keen Ice in the Kentucky Derby, both on May 2.

"Getting a horse into any of these races is a dream come true, but to get one in all three in the same year is unbelievable," said Metcalf. "We plan to enjoy every minute of it.

"Donegal Racing sometimes uses the tagline, 'where Derby Dreams come true.' That has definitely been the case for us."

Metcalf said that qualifying and performing in big races is nothing new for Donegal, as the partnership has been in the Derby three of the past six years. Qualifying for the big three races at Churchill Downs during Derby weekend, however, exceeded even the wildest of optimistic expectations.
